Ho can I call a macro in an other Excel workbook that is in an other
dir. --- Message posted from http://www.ExcelForum.com/ |

You have to open the workbook first in order to execute the
macro. Then use Application.Run to execute that actual macro. E.g., Application.Run "Book2.xls!TheMacro" -- Cordially, Chip Pearson Microsoft MVP - Excel Pearson Software Consulting, LLC www.cpearson.com "Davwe" wrote in message ...
